Full Job Description

As a Waiting List Officer for the ECG department your main duties will cover:
+ Managing waiting lists by priority and date order
+ Booking those next on the list to a date and time that suits them
+ Answering and signposting general enquiries from patients calling our appointments line
+ Working collaboratively with the directorate team to ensure the capacity & demand balance is right
+ Organising your workload and being organised
+ Helping to supervise when needed the reception team
+ Covering on reception when needed
+ working with CDC providers to ensure capacity is filled

The successful candidate will be part of a friendly and dedicated team, supporting the effective booking of patients for their diagnostic appointments and helping to maintain the smooth flow of patients through the department. This is a key front-line role, ensuring a positive experience for patients and supporting the delivery of a high-quality, efficient service.
You will be responsible for a range of administrative and reception duties, including managing appointment systems, liaising with clinical staff, handling patient enquiries both face-to-face and over the telephone, and ensuring patient records are accurately maintained. Excellent communication skills, attention to detail, and the ability to work well under pressure in a busy environment are essential.
This role would suit someone who is organised, flexible, and committed to providing excellent patient care, with the ability to work both independently and as part of a team. In return, we offer the opportunity to work within a supportive department, with access to ongoing training and development within the Trust.

Stockport Foundation Trust is one of four 'specialist' hospital sites in Greater Manchester. Being a 'specialist' hospital will enhance our general surgery, anaesthetics, critical care and emergency medicine for the benefit of people in Stockport, High Peak, Cheshire and across Greater Manchester.
